Moffatt's high school football team, the Union City Golden Tornadoes, won consecutive Class 1A Tennessee state championships in his junior and senior seasons (2013 and 2014).
He had 36 tackles with an interception, five passes broken and a forced fumble in his senior season before suffering shoulder injury and using a medical redshirt.
As a redshirt senior, Moffat led the Blue Raiders with 98 tackles and three interceptions and was named honorable mention All-Conference USA.
